What is a Maine job?
A Maine job refers to employment opportunities available in the state of Maine, spanning various industries such as tourism, healthcare, fishing, forestry, and manufacturing. Many jobs in Maine are seasonal due to the state's strong tourism and outdoor recreation sectors. Additionally, industries like shipbuilding, aquaculture, and technology are growing, providing diverse career options.

What is the Training Coordinator at the Maine Criminal Justice Academy responsible for? The Training Coordinator's position at the Maine Criminal Justice Academy is an essential component of the Academy's operation involving the coordination and provision of education and training, to all new and existing law enforcement and corrections personnel. Work includes developing curricula, establishing criteria for educational goals and objectives, and for selecting and evaluating instructors who will be teaching law enforcement and corrections programs. Work is performed under limited supervision. Statewide travel is required. This MCJA Training Coordinator's position is one of six coordinators in the workgroup who together work to fulfill the essential statutory requirements as outlined in 25 M.R.S. chapter 341 of our core mission. This position is vital and has an important impact on law enforcement and corrections agencies throughout the state.
Primary responsibilities include:
- Plans, schedules, conducts and evaluates corrections and law enforcement training programs.
- Instruct students in specialty areas.
- Identify and select instructors of courses and design tests for student evaluations. Develops and writes training course goals/objectives and lesson plans.
- Researches and identifies new and changing training subjects.
- Training and certification for all full and part-time law enforcement and corrections officers.
- Processes Out-of-state waiver requests.
- Acts as primary physical fitness trainer and tester.
- Prepares all the documentation for the MCJA Board of Trustees to approve the above-named certifications.
- Helps other MCJA staff on all related programs held at the Maine Criminal Justice Academy.
- Teaches the Methods of Instruction class to develop newly certified instructors.
Skills or knowledge required:
- Excellent written and verbal skills.
- Excellent computer/technology skills.
Minimum qualifications:
A Bachelors Degree in Criminal Justice, Public Administration, or Public Education and two (2) years experience in the criminal justice system. Directly related experience may be substituted for education on a year-for-year basis.

Benefits of working for the State of Maine:
No matter where you work across Maine state government, you find employees who embody our state motto-"Dirigo" or "I lead"-as they provide essential services to Mainers every day. We believe in supporting our workforce's health and wellbeing with a valuable total compensation package, including:
- Work-Life Fit- Rest is essential. Take time for yourself using13 paid holidays,12 days of sick leave, and3+ weeks of vacation leaveannually. Vacation leave accrual increases with years of service, and overtime-exempt employees receive personal leave.
- Health Insurance Coverage- The State of Maine pays 85%-95%of employee-only premiums ($11,196.96 - $12,514.32 annual value), depending on salary. Use this chart to find the premium costsfor you and your family, including the percentage of dependent coverage paid by the State.
- Dental Insurance- The State of Maine pays 100% of employee-only dental premiums ($387.92 annual value).
- Retirement Plan- The State contributes the equivalent of 14.11% of the employee's pay towards the Maine Public Employees Retirement System (MainePERS) for MSEA, or 18.91% for Confidential employees.
State employees are eligible for an extensive and highly competitive benefits package, covering many aspects of wellness. Learn about additional wellness benefits for State employees from the Office of Employee Health and Wellness.
Note: Benefits may vary somewhat according to specific collective bargaining agreements and are prorated for anything less than full-time.
